Formula: bright-light hours plus window direction score, minus distance and obstruction penalties.
What this tool does
This checker scores whether a plant location is likely bright enough based on daily light, window direction, distance, and obstructions. It is a placement tool, not plant astrology with a progress bar.
How to use it
Estimate bright indirect light hours for the spot. Give south or west windows higher direction scores if they are not blocked. Add an obstruction penalty for curtains, nearby buildings, trees, or deep shelves.
How to use the result
Higher scores are better for bright-light plants. Lower scores suggest moving the plant closer to the window, choosing a lower-light plant, or adding a grow light.
